Default TR6060 question

i am confused and could use some help. I am installing a supercharged LSA 6.2 crate engine from GM performance. I ordered a tr6060 six speed trans part number 24258817 from GM performance also and receved the trans but it is not what I expected. the one I recieved has the shift rod coming out t he back

and the place where the remote shifter goes looks like this


all the other 24258817 transmissions I looked at have the remote shifter on the top like this
http://www.crateenginedepot.com/TR60...17-P18242.aspx


what part number should I have ordered?

The 2010 Camaro SS is a TR6060 and has an external shifter.


You can mount a shifter on the detent cover (McLeod),
https://ls1tech.com/forums/conversio...68-camaro.html
but if you need the shifter further back, you have two options, build a custom shifter - my way
https://ls1tech.com/forums/conversio...get-build.html
Or- change the mainshaft and tailhousing - a nice build
